Factors to consider when choosing a golf ball for amateurs
When choosing a golf ball for amateur players, several factors should be considered to enhance their game. Firstly, compression rating is crucial as it impacts the feel and distance of the shot. Amateurs with slower swing speeds should opt for low compression balls for better performance. Secondly, cover material influences spin and durability; urethane covers offer more control but may wear out faster than ionomer covers. Lastly, price point should be considered as higher-end balls may provide better performance but come at a premium cost. Balancing these factors can help amateurs find the best golf ball suited to their game.

3. TaylorMade TP5
**3. TaylorMade TP5**
The TaylorMade TP5 golf ball is a popular choice among amateur players for its exceptional performance on the course. Known for its five-layer construction, the TP5 offers a combination of distance, control, and feel that can greatly benefit players looking to enhance their game.
One key feature of the TaylorMade TP5 is its Tri-Fast Core technology, which helps maximize energy transfer for increased speed and distance off the tee. This core is complemented by a dual-spin cover that provides excellent greenside control, allowing players to stop the ball more effectively on approach shots.
Additionally, the TP5's seamless 322 dimple pattern promotes a penetrating ball flight and stable trajectory in various weather conditions. This consistency in flight can help amateur golfers achieve more predictable results on each shot.
Overall, the TaylorMade TP5 is a top-rated golf ball for amateur players seeking a balance of distance, control, and feel on the course. Its innovative design and performance features make it a reliable option for those looking to elevate their game and improve their overall experience on the links.

5. Bridgestone e6 Soft
5.5. Bridgestone e6 Soft
The Bridgestone e6 Soft golf ball is a popular choice among amateur players for its exceptional feel and performance on the course. Designed to provide a soft feel off the clubface, the e6 Soft offers low driver spin for straighter shots and improved accuracy. The advanced mantle layer helps reduce sidespin for enhanced control, making it ideal for golfers looking to improve their game.
With a seamless cover and Delta Dimple design, the Bridgestone e6 Soft delivers consistent ball flight and distance, even in windy conditions. The soft gradational core ensures optimal compression for maximum energy transfer, resulting in impressive distance off the tee and precise shots into the green.
Overall, the Bridgestone e6 Soft is a reliable option for amateur golfers seeking consistency, control, and distance in their game. Its combination of soft feel, low driver spin, and enhanced accuracy make it a top-rated choice for players looking to elevate their performance on the course.
